President Maithripala Sirisena has requested the public to exercise their franchise peacefully instead of engaging in illegal campaigning and refraining from being deceived by gossip.
Issuing a special statement, the President's Media Division quoted the President as saying that the power and duty of a citizen, is to vote for a candidate of their choice.
He had also said that the environment required to conduct a free election has been created in the country by empowering the police, tri-forces, and other security units.
President Sirisena's term in office which began in 2015 will end following this year's presidential election.
